Georgia's housing stock features a lot of traditional asphalt shingle roofs, which can struggle with the prolonged heat and humidity. This climate can accelerate wear and tear, leading to issues like blistering and premature aging. Metal roofing offers a robust alternative, standing up exceptionally well to the intense sun and heavy rains common in the Atlanta area. What is the cheapest time of year to get a new roof in Georgia?

While Georgia's weather can be unpredictable, there isn't a drastically cheaper season for roofing. However, avoiding the peak of summer heat or the height of hurricane season might offer slightly more scheduling flexibility. It's always best to address roofing needs promptly to prevent further damage and potential cost increases.

Does roof sealant work on older Georgia homes?

For older homes in Georgia, roof sealant can sometimes be a temporary fix for minor issues like small cracks or seam leaks. However, if the underlying roofing material is significantly deteriorated, sealant alone won't provide a lasting solution.
